Z tego przewodnika dowiesz się, jak skonfigurować protokół OAuth2 na potrzeby dostępu przez interfejs API za pomocą własnych danych logowania i kont usługi. Należy to zrobić tylko raz, chyba że unieważnisz lub usuniesz dane logowania OAuth2.
Tworzenie danych logowania OAuth2
Wygeneruj identyfikator konta usługi (przekazywania) i plik *.JSON
, postępując zgodnie z powiązanymi instrukcjami, a potem wróć na tę stronę.
Skonfiguruj bibliotekę klienta
Ustaw ścieżkę pliku JSON klucza prywatnego i przekaż identyfikator konta w konfiguracji. Jeśli używasz pliku googleads.properties
, dodaj te elementy:
jsonKeyFilePath=PRIVATE_KEY_FILE_PATH
impersonatedEmail=DELEGATE_ACCOUNT
Jeśli używasz zmiennych środowiskowych, dodaj do środowiska lub konfiguracji Bash ten kod:
export GOOGLE_ADS_JSON_KEY_FILE_PATH=PRIVATE_KEY_FILE_PATH
export GOOGLE_ADS_IMPERSONATED_EMAIL=DELEGATE_ACCOUNT_ID